You are here

public function DisplayTest::validate in Drupal 8

Same name and namespace in other branches
  1. 9 core/modules/views/tests/modules/views_test_data/src/Plugin/views/display/DisplayTest.php \Drupal\views_test_data\Plugin\views\display\DisplayTest::validate()

Validate that the plugin is correct and can be saved.

Return value

An array of error strings to tell the user what is wrong with this plugin.

Overrides DisplayPluginBase::validate

File

core/modules/views/tests/modules/views_test_data/src/Plugin/views/display/DisplayTest.php, line 148

Class

DisplayTest
Defines a Display test plugin.

Namespace

Drupal\views_test_data\Plugin\views\display

Code

public function validate() {
  $errors = parent::validate();
  foreach ($this->view->displayHandlers as $display_handler) {
    $errors[] = 'error';
  }
  return $errors;
}